With the ink not yet dry from the end of the 2011/12 season, preparations at Arklow Rugby Club have already resumed in earnest for the 2012/13 season…
Pre-season training has begun and although earlier than usual, this renewed enthusiasm will come as no surprise to members as the club have lots to be positive about for the season ahead.
After a couple of tough years in the club Arklow Rugby Club have seen their fortunes return in recent years. This has mainly come about through a combination of factors. These include the emergence of the ladies team which has brought a renewed vigour to the club, a growing minis section which has seen increased support from parents, the performance of the club’s successful Under-19 side under coach Barney Hynes and an increase in training numbers throughout last season. This culminated in the 1st team securing promotion to Division 2B of Leinster League at the end of last season.
Arklow now face into the new season with the same squad plus a couple of new faces. This includes former captain and Old Wesley 1st team regular Richard Murphy who returns after a couple of successful seasons with the Dublin 4 club.
Arklow have also appointed a new head coach, Patrick Collins. Collins, a Grade 3 IRFU coach brings a wealth of coaching experience to the club having previously coached The Irish Exiles, been a development coach at Munster and a coach at Wanderers. The club have also appointed a new captain in out-half Mark Van Esbeck. It is hoped that with their strengthened squad and Collins coaching experience Arklow Rugby Club can equip themselves successfully in what is sure to be a challenging division.
